"Fact check" nghĩa là gì?

Photo by Charles Deluvio on Unsplash

"Fact check" nghĩa là kiểm tra tính thực tế, xác minh tính chính xác của thông tin đã công bố trước đó (thông cáo báo chí...)

Ví dụ
I have a television fantasy. Whenever the US president appears (xuất hiện), he gets fact-checked, as he goes, in real-time.

We are working to fact check and correct misinformation (thông tin sai lệch) on Covid-19. You can see our fact checks here. If you’ve seen something you’re unsure about, you can Ask Full Fact to help.

Fact-checking organization (tổ chức) Snopes has been forced to scale back (thu hẹp) its routine content production (sản xuất nội dung) and special projects, as the amount of misinformation caused by the COVID-19 pandemic (đại dịch) has overwhelmed its fact-checkers.

It's hard to know where to begin fact checking. President Donald Trump's latest coronavirus press conference (họp báo) on Saturday afternoon was littered (lộn xộn) with false claims about both the pandemic crisis (khủng hoảng đại dịch) and various unrelated matters (vấn đề không liên quan) Trump decided to talk about, from North Korea and Iran to Chinese tariffs (thuế quan).
